Aerosol cans use compressed gases to propel the contents out of the can. Which of the following is the best explanation for why

aerosol cans should not be overheated? (2 points) The aerosol cans may form a leak, and the compressed gases may condense into a liquid. Gases do not expand when heated, so the excess heat may cause the can to implode. As the can heats, the compressed gases will expand, causing the can to explode. As pressure increases, the gas in the aerosol can vaporize, and the can will no longer work.

Answer:

As the can heats, the compressed gases will expand, causing the can to explode

Explanation:

We know that the gases in the aerosol can would assume the shape and volume of the can. The volume of the can would be the volume of the compressed gas.

As heat is added to the can, the aerosol gases would gain kinetic energy and their speed would increase. The gases would begin to expand and would require more space in order to move. This would indirectly increase the pressures between gas molecules and the walls of the can as collisions soars.  

A point would eventually be reached where the gas agitation would lead to an explosion.

Overheated aerosol cans would explode.
